Job Description
Responsible for the analysis, replication, and resolution of problems ranging from simple to highly complex, as well as the follow-up of incoming cases, serving frontline support customers hosted in the Radixx reservation system and using our broad portfolio of solutions.
Provides technical support through different communication channels using advanced software and diagnostic tools, as well as recommends best business practices to customers regarding application usability and system maintenance.
Acts as a liaison between different internal teams, ensuring a prompt resolution is achieved while working in a high-speed, multitasking environment. Demonstrates a high sense of urgency for sensitive issues and ensures the appropriate level of communication is maintained with internal and external teams according to defined service level agreements.

Sabre Corporation Insights
What We Do
We are a software and technology company that powers the global travel industry. With decades of revolutionary firsts, our team of experts drive innovation and ingenuity in the industry. Today, we are creating a new marketplace for personalized travel. We partner with airlines, hoteliers, agencies and other travel partners to retail, distribute and fulfill travel. We are committed to helping customers operate more efficiently, drive revenue and offer personalized traveler experiences with next-generation technology solutions. Positioned at the center of the business of travel, our platform connects people with experiences that matter in their lives. Sabre's technology powers the nearly US$8 trillion travel industry. Our technology and data-driven solutions help our airline, hotel, travel agency and corporate customers grow their businesses and transform the traveler experience. The scale, breadth and depth of our technology is unmatched and sustains a complex industry. We provide an open and stable platform to deliver flexible, reliable and scalable solutions. Over the years, we have shaped and modernized the travel industry. We pioneered online travel agencies, corporate booking tools, revenue management, and web and mobile itinerary tools, to name a few. Our travel marketplace transacts more than US$120 billion of travel spend per year. And we are the world’s largest provider of airline and hotel technology.
